Thomas Tuchel has confirmed that Jamal Musiala is fit enough to start against Manchester United on Wednesday.

Bayern Munich coach Thomas Tuchel has revealed that Jamal Musiala is ready to start against Manchester United in the Champions League on Wednesday night after working his way back from injury.
“Jamal Musiala is ready to start. He can play between 60 and 75 minutes,” the Bayern coach told reporters at his pre-match press conference.
Whether or not he will actually start, however, remains to be seen.
“It has not yet been decided whether he will start tomorrow. He can also play together with Thomas Müller.
Musiala replaced Müller after an hour of Bayern’s 2-2 draw with Bayer Leverkusen on Friday.
